Fmvss 108/halogen headlamp assemblies
Defect Summary
Certain tyc halogen type headlamp assemblies p/n 20-6644-00 sold as aftermarket equipment for 2005-2006 nissan altima passenger vehicles. the photometric were misaligned which does not comply with federal motor vehicle safety standard no. 108, lamps, reflective devices, and associated equipment.
Safety Consequence
Misalignment of the lights diminishes frontal illumination which could result in a vehicle crash.
Corrective Action
Genera will notify owners and offer to repurchase the noncompliant lamps. the recall began on october 25, 2007. owners can contact genera at 714-522-6688.

What is recall 07E087000?
NHTSA recall 07E087000 was issued by Genera Corporation on October 25, 2007. It addresses: Fmvss 108/halogen headlamp assemblies. The recall affects approximately 4,654 vehicles, with the defect involving the Exterior Lighting component.
